| source ./globals |
| |
| set file_in "$test_dir/job_script" |
| |
| if {[check_config_select "linear"]} { |
| skip "Test requires SelectType!=linear" |
| } |
| |
| make_bash_script $file_in {echo CUDA_VISIBLE_DEVICES=$CUDA_VISIBLE_DEVICES} |
| |
| proc run_gpu_test { gres_cnt } { |
| global max_job_delay srun number file_in |
| |
| set timeout $max_job_delay |
| set bad_format 0 |
| set devices 0 |
| set invalid 0 |
| spawn $srun -N1 -n1 --gres=gpu:$gres_cnt -t1 $file_in |
| expect { |
| -re "Unable to allocate" { |
| incr invalid |
| exp_continue |
| } |
| -re "CUDA_VISIBLE_DEVICES=($number),($number),($number)" { |
| if {$expect_out(1,string) == $expect_out(2,string)} { |
| incr bad_format |
| } elseif {$expect_out(2,string) == $expect_out(3,string)} { |
| incr bad_format |
| } elseif {$expect_out(1,string) == $expect_out(3,string)} { |
| incr bad_format |
| } |
| incr devices +3 |
| exp_continue |
| } |
| -re "CUDA_VISIBLE_DEVICES=($number),($number)" { |
| if {$expect_out(1,string) == $expect_out(2,string)} { |
| incr bad_format |
| } |
| incr devices +2 |
| exp_continue |
| } |
| -re "CUDA_VISIBLE_DEVICES=($number)" { |
| incr devices |
| exp_continue |
| } |
| -re "CUDA_VISIBLE_DEVICES=" { |
| log_warn "This could indicate that gres.conf lacks device files for the GPUs" |
| exp_continue |
| } |
| timeout { |
| fail "srun not responding" |
| } |
| eof { |
| wait |
| } |
| } |
| if {$invalid != 0} { |
| log_warn "Insufficient resources to test $gres_cnt GPUs" |
| return 0 |
| } elseif {$bad_format != 0} { |
| fail "Duplicated device number in GRES allocation" |
| } elseif {$devices != $gres_cnt} { |
| fail "Expected $gres_cnt GPUs, but was allocated $devices" |
| } |
| return 0 |
| } |
| |
| proc run_gpu_fail { gres_spec } { |
| global max_job_delay srun number file_in |
| |
| set timeout $max_job_delay |
| set bad_format 0 |
| set devices 0 |
| set invalid 0 |
| spawn $srun -N1 -n1 --gres=$gres_spec -t1 $file_in |
| expect { |
| -re "Invalid" { |
| incr invalid |
| exp_continue |
| } |
| timeout { |
| fail "srun not responding" |
| } |
| eof { |
| wait |
| } |
| } |
| if {$invalid == 0} { |
| fail "Failure to reject job with invalid GRES specification" |
| } else { |
| log_debug "Error is expected, no worries" |
| } |
| return |
| } |
| |
| # |
| # Test if gres/gpu is configured |
| # |
| set gpu_cnt [get_highest_gres_count 1 "gpu"] |
| if {$gpu_cnt < 1} { |
| skip "This test can not be run without gres/gpu configured" |
| } |
| log_debug "GPUs:$gpu_cnt" |
| |
| # |
| # Spawn a job via srun to print environment variables and |
| # check count GPU devices allocated |
| # |
| for {set inx 1} {$inx <= $gpu_cnt && $inx <= 3} {incr inx} { |
| run_gpu_test $inx |
| } |
| |
| # |
| # Spawn a job via srun with various invalid GRES specifications |
| # |
| log_info "Test various invalid GRES specifications" |
| run_gpu_fail "gpu:" |
| run_gpu_fail "gpu::" |
| run_gpu_fail "gpu:tesla:" |
| run_gpu_fail "gpu:tesla:INVALID_COUNT" |
| run_gpu_fail "gpu:INVALID_TYPE:" |
| run_gpu_fail "gpu:INVALID_TYPE:INVALID_COUNT" |
